Hey Omniva team,

Following assets are loaded on product category and product single pages:

  • omnivalt-library-mapping-css
  • omnivalt-library-leaflet-css
  • omnivalt-block-frontend-checkout
  • omnivalt-library-mapping-js
  • omnivalt-library-leaflet-js

For optimization purposes, they could be omitted from loading if they are not used on the page. There are no need to load these assets as they are suppose to execute logic related to checkout/cart pages.

This is related to Omniva Gutenberg Block integration, I am not using Gutenberg editor on the site where the issue is happening.

Would be good if we could have a switchable constant or filter to disable this part of functionality.
